Output 2aceab52efedeee858c2a66968b83d0b5dc61bc92bc650e56f1d54b6c741176b:29

value
7808034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f3c55128d317c6230fbe9dafbf5898845be5bc OP_EQUAL
address
3M1iXWXqA8yTSEn7joVY8sghgf8qXBajKq
transaction
2aceab52efedeee858c2a66968b83d0b5dc61bc92bc650e56f1d54b6c741176b
spent
true